About ITALIAN STYLE DICED WITH BASIL & OREGANO TOMATOES
ITALIAN STYLE DICED WITH BASIL & OREGANO TOMATOES is a very low-calorie food with 28 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is carbohydrates, providing 0.8g of protein, 5.7g of carbohydrates, and 0.8g of fat. It also contributes 0.8g of dietary fiber per serving. This food belongs to the Tomatoes category.
Ingredients
DICED TOMATOES, TOMATO JUICE, SUGAR, SOYBEAN OIL, SALT, SPICES, DEHYDRATED ONION, BASIL, OREGANO, GARLIC POWDER, CALCIUM CHLORIDE (FIRMING AGENT), OLIVE OIL, CITRIC ACID, NATURAL FLAVORS.
